feat: add authenticate_request with jwt verification and partial decode
- TokenPartialUser frozen dataclass for unverified JWT payload extraction - AuthState frozen dataclass for authentication results - decode_access_token_claims extracts user info without signature verification - _extract_token_from_headers handles Authorization and x-stack-auth headers - sync_authenticate_request and async_authenticate_request compose with JWKS verifier

def decode_access_token_claims(token: str) -> TokenPartialUser | None:
|
||||
"""Extract partial user info from a JWT without verifying its signature.
|
||||
|
||||
This performs a base64url decode of the payload segment only.
|
||||
It does NOT verify the token's signature, expiry, or issuer.
|
||||
|
||||
Args:
|
||||
token: The encoded JWT string.
|
||||
|
||||
Returns:
|
||||
A ``TokenPartialUser`` if the payload contains at least a ``sub`` claim,
|
||||
or ``None`` if the token is malformed or missing required fields.
|
||||
"""
|
||||
try:
|
||||
parts = token.split(".")
|
||||
if len(parts) < 2:
|
||||
return None
|
||||
|
||||
payload_b64 = parts[1]
|
||||
# Add padding for base64url decoding
|
||||
payload_b64 += "=" * (-len(payload_b64) % 4)
|
||||
payload_bytes = base64.urlsafe_b64decode(payload_b64)
|
||||
data = json.loads(payload_bytes)
|
||||
|
||||
user_id: str = data["sub"]
|
||||
|
||||
return TokenPartialUser(
|
||||
id=user_id,
|
||||
display_name=data.get("name"),
|
||||
primary_email=data.get("email"),
|
||||
primary_email_verified=data.get("email_verified", False),
|
||||
is_anonymous=data.get("is_anonymous", False),
|
||||
is_multi_factor_required=data.get("is_multi_factor_required", False),
|
||||
is_restricted=data.get("is_restricted", False),
|
||||
restricted_reason=data.get("restricted_reason"),
|
||||
)
|
||||
except (ValueError, KeyError, json.JSONDecodeError):
|
||||
return None

def _extract_token_from_headers(headers: Mapping[str, str]) -> str | None:
|
||||
"""Extract a bearer token from request headers.
|
||||
|
||||
Checks the ``Authorization`` header first (case-insensitive),
|
||||
then falls back to the ``x-stack-auth`` JSON header's ``accessToken`` field.
|
||||
|
||||
Args:
|
||||
headers: A mapping of header names to values.
|
||||
|
||||
Returns:
|
||||
The extracted token string, or ``None`` if no valid token is found.
|
||||
"""
|
||||
# Check Authorization header (both cases for case-sensitive mappings)
|
||||
auth_value = headers.get("Authorization") or headers.get("authorization")
|
||||
if auth_value and auth_value.startswith("Bearer "):
|
||||
return auth_value[len("Bearer "):]
|
||||
|
||||
# Fallback to x-stack-auth JSON header
|
||||
stack_auth_value = headers.get("x-stack-auth")
|
||||
if stack_auth_value:
|
||||
try:
|
||||
data = json.loads(stack_auth_value)
|
||||
access_token = data.get("accessToken")
|
||||
if access_token:
|
||||
return access_token # type: ignore[no-any-return]
|
||||
except (json.JSONDecodeError, AttributeError):
|
||||
pass
|
||||
|
||||
return None
